Output 3b814d470aa2c3326aa726f36058e924e29a4a7f7fbe163c272484de557e59e9:2

value
12809
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1fe35976e1e6021bbaa7293128f885407c48e7aa OP_EQUAL
address
34bdE1TFowuPBewuv271XW1kREwrVMsfvB
transaction
3b814d470aa2c3326aa726f36058e924e29a4a7f7fbe163c272484de557e59e9
spent
true